JP Nadda to Launch Dashboard for Monitoring Healthcare Delivery Standards Compliance

Union Health Minister JP Nadda will launch a new dashboard on Friday to help health facilities across the country monitor how well they meet healthcare standards. Officials announced that this dashboard aims to ensure that all public health facilities maintain high-quality care.

The Indian Public Health Standards (IPHS) guidelines, which were first introduced in 2007 and updated in 2022, set quality benchmarks for healthcare from primary to secondary levels. These guidelines ensure that healthcare services are consistent, accessible, and accountable across the nation. Public health institutions are encouraged to assess themselves and work towards closing any gaps in their services.

In addition to the dashboard, two other initiatives will also be launched by Minister Nadda on Friday:

1. Virtual NQAS Assessment for Ayushman Arogya Mandirs (AAM) Sub-centres: This system will allow virtual assessments of health sub-centres, which will then receive the NQAS (National Quality Assurance Standards) certificate.

2. New Functionality in FoSCoS: The Food Safety and Compliance System (FoSCoS) will have a new feature for the instant issuance of licenses and registrations. FoSCoS is an advanced IT platform that addresses food safety regulatory needs across India.

These initiatives are seen as innovative steps in improving the quality assurance framework for public health facilities. They are expected to save time and reduce costs.

The NQAS certificate for Integrated Public Health Laboratories (IPHL) located at district hospitals will also be released during the event. These standards aim to improve the quality and management of testing systems in these labs, which will positively impact the reliability of test results and help gain the trust of clinicians, patients, and the public.

Revised guidelines for the Kayakalp program will also be released on Friday. Kayakalp is an initiative that encourages public health facilities to maintain cleanliness and enhance the quality of services.

“A ground-breaking new functionality for the instant issuance of licenses and registrations through the Food Safety and Compliance System (FoSCoS) will also be launched. FoSCoS is a state-of-the-art, Pan-India IT platform designed to address all food safety regulatory needs,” the statement said.

“This innovative system simplifies the licensing and registration processes, offering an enhanced user experience,” the statement added.
